This shark shares the name of the cetaceans because of its massive size, but it is a fish that can measure up to 20 meters long, although it has an average size between 9 and 12 meters long. Whale sharks are active feeders and usually targets concentrations of plankton or fish. It is estimated that Young whale sharks can eat up to 45 pounds of plankton per day. Whale sharks also feed on small nektonic organisms such as krill, crab ...

WebCan A Shark Eat A Whole Whale? A fully grown great white shark will eat around 0.5 – 3% of its total body weight each hunt, but when given the opportunity to eat a whale it may eat more than this. That said, even the largest shark is not able to consume a full whole carcass by itself. Other sharks and fish may come along for an easy meal.
